Specifications Model: OEP50Wx2
Work: Class D (PWM modulation)
Chip: TPA3116D2
Number of Channels: two-channel
Power supply range:DC4.5-24V
Quiescent Current: 28mA (21V power supply)
Sleep current:. <0.4mA (21V power supply)
Recommended speaker: 50-100W
SNR: 102dB
Harmonic distortion: <0.1%
Frequency range: 20Hz-20kHz
Amplifier Gain: 36dB (the board can be set to 20dB, 26dB)
Input impedance: 1KΩ
Output Impedance:. 8-3.2 Ω
Output Power:
40W THD + N = 10% (8Ω, 24V)
30W THD + N = 10% (8Ω, 21V)
50W THD + N = 10% (4Ω, 21V)
25W THD + N = 10% (4Ω, 15V)
17W THD + N = 10% (4Ω, 12V)
32W THD + N = 1% (8Ω, 24V)
40W THD + N = 1% (4Ω, 21V)
17W more than need to add heat sink
Protection: Output short circuit protection (Troubleshooting immediate recovery).
Working temperature: -40-85 ℃
Size: 25x 18x2.5mm (L * W * H)
NOTE: 4 ohms speaker does not recommend more than 21V power supply.
